1) The one year MBA, does it cause a problem with placements for career switchers like me? I did see a few others ask this question before but have not gotten a solid grasp on the answer.

Alfred: There is no yes or no answer. It depends on how hard u try and to an extent luck. Doing an internship, showing companies u have interest matters. So, INSEAD's janaury batch is an even better option. In general I am told that consulting companies are more open to career switchers than IB's.

2) Does INSEAD release any placement data other the PDF on their website about where the placements are happening? I am just weighing the chances for a guy like me getting placed in the US post MBA. The PDF on INSEAD's website has only overall number of people placed in each region and not specifics.

Alfred: Don;t expect much in US. As said in previous post, how will u justify to companies ur US as career choice. Why US? Best go to US schools if u are dead sure on US as ur only option to be.
What specifics do u need? INSEAD's website has a career report, which details how many are in which country. Look carefully, I personally found it to be quite detailled and exhaustive.

3) Does the Jan intake have any advantage over the Sep intake or vice versa?

Alfred: I would say internship option makes it better for those set on Ibanking. Otherwise, I am told all's same.

4) Lastly does INSEAD ask for some proof to waive the TOEFL, if yes what would that be?

Alfred: They didnt; ask me anything. They understand that most indian colleges are english medium
